DMP Posted April 23, 2007 Report Share Posted April 23, 2007 (edited) Hi, Im a fairly new member on here and possibly looking to buy a used Banshee in the near future. Im parting out my Blaster and using the money for it. Im wondering the typical price range of a "running" used Banshee goes for. The ones with the a-arms. Ive seen some for about $2500 on Craigslist and on Ebay it seems a little higher. Do you think I could pick one up for under $2000? BTW, what year did Yamaha switch over to a-arms on the Banshee? NYUK Posted April 23, 2007 Report Share Posted April 23, 2007 91 and up, a arms.i have bought many a banshee for 1500 to 1800. you need to look. be vigilant.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
fastrthnu Posted April 23, 2007 Report Share Posted April 23, 2007 depends on how it runs, last rebuild, mods, and condition. if you want a good fixeruper, you could find one for 1500 give or take a few,. but You could find a nice garage kept bike with pipes n small mods in good shape for 2500. As far as banshees go,... 80% of the time your not going to find a deal on eGay. Craiglist or a cycle trader is probley your best bet. Find a good deal and talk them down. 2500,..... "Give you 2000 cash right now for it" works alot. You could also buy a beater,. keep the motor, part it out and use the money to buy a nice new rolling chassis someone is selling.
